    Old Sturbridge Village is the main attraction in town.

    Old Sturbridge Village is the main attraction in town. It is a lovely trip for families. You enter the Village and you are transported to the 1800s. It is a full working village separate from the outside world. Once inside there are no cars, telephone wires, or anything to distract you from enjoying your day living in history. Sturbridge also has many wonderful restaurants. Everything from a local gem-Cedar Street Grill, to pizza, fast food and ice cream. Not far from Sturbridge (5 minutes) is Tree House Brewery which is known world wide! Three times a year you will find the Brimfield Antiques Market just 15 minutes down Route 20.
